DRER Dispute Resolution Education Resources, Inc.
DRER informs the public about the benefits of mediation and manages or
develops grant programs that provide mediation services to individuals
with special needs. It works with state agencies and other
organizations to deliver those services through the Community Dispute
Resolution Program (CDRP). The CDRP is Michigan's network of local
conflict resolution centers, serving all counties in the state.
DRER's activities include:
▪
Michigan Special Education Mediation Program (MSEMP).
▪
Mental Health Mediation Pilot Project.
